What is the Winter Fuel Payment?

The Winter Fuel Payment is a one-off payment made annually to help eligible pensioners pay for their heating bills. It’s a significant support for many, ensuring they can keep warm without financial strain.

Eligibility Criteria

To qualify for the Winter Fuel Payment, you generally need to have been born on or before September 25, 1956, and lived in the UK for at least one day during the qualifying week. How Much Can You Claim?

The amount you can claim varies depending on your circumstances, such as whether you live alone or with someone else who is also eligible. Generally, the payment ranges from £250 to £600.

How to Claim

Most eligible pensioners receive the Winter Fuel Payment automatically. If you’ve received it before, you likely don’t need to reapply. However, if you’re claiming for the first time, you may need to contact the Winter Fuel Payment Centre. — Gisou Lip Oil: Hydration & Shine Review

Claiming Process

  1. Check Eligibility: Ensure you meet the criteria.
  2. Contact the Winter Fuel Payment Centre: If you haven't received it automatically.
  3. Provide Necessary Information: This may include your National Insurance number and bank details.

Key Dates

The qualifying week is usually in September, and payments are typically made between November and December. It's essential to be aware of these dates to ensure you receive your payment on time.

Additional Support

Besides the Winter Fuel Payment, additional support is available for pensioners struggling with heating costs. This includes the Warm Home Discount Scheme and Cold Weather Payment.

Other Schemes

  • Warm Home Discount Scheme: A one-off discount on your electricity bill.
  • Cold Weather Payment: Paid when the average temperature in your area is recorded as, or forecast to be, zero degrees Celsius or below for seven consecutive days.
